Ogemaw Heights found a leader in Taylor Illig as the team took down Bullock Creek on Tuesday. Illig turned in her biggest game of the season, getting on base in three of her five plate appearances with three RBI, one triple, and one stolen base. That triple marked the first that she has hit this season.
Coming up, Illig and Ogemaw Heights will square off against Mio-Au Sable at 4:00 p.m. on Wednesday. Thanks in part to Illig's efforts, the Falcons will roll in on a three-game winning streak.
